1998 ISUZU TROOPER CHANGES:
MORE THAN SKIN DEEP

For 1998, Trooper is significantly improved. While the exterior has received subtle, but significant styling changes; a new front grille, bumper, headlights and front fenders, beneath the new sheetmetal, the drive-tra.in has undergone major improvements. Virtually every system from air-intake to final drive has been changed or refined.

The 1998, Trooper comes in three trim levels, the "S," the "S" with performance package and "S" with luxury package.

All Trooper models are equipped with an extensive list of standard equipment including, four-wheel drive, a 3.5-liter, 215 horsepower, DOHC, V-6 engine, four-wheel anti-lock disc brakes, independent front and multi-link rear suspension, engine speed-sensing power steering, cruise control, dual front air-bags, air conditioning, power windows, door locks and outside mirrors. A six-speaker stereo AM/FM cassette player, anti-theft system and remote opening hood and fuel door round out the basic package.

New this year is a hard spare tire cover, color-keyed to the vehicle's body color and integrated into the Trooper's overall styling. The "S" model is the least expensive Trooper and the only one to offer a five-speed manual transmission as standard equipment. The "S" with Performance Package and "S" with Luxury Package come standard with four-speed automatic transmissions, limited slip differential and Torque On Demand (TOD)™. Also standard on "Performance" and "Luxury" models are power folding dual mirrors with remote control and electric defogger, variable intermittent windshield wipers with washers, privacy side and rear door glass, rear passenger foot rests, cargo floor rails and carpeted front door map pockets. The "S Luxury" comes standard with power moonroof, six-way, power driver's seat, four-way for passenger, heated driver and passenger seats, leather seating surfaces, in-dash AM/FM stereo cassette player with six speakers and six-disc CD changer.

1998 ISUZU TROOPER' S IMPROVED ENGINE,
FEATURES MORE POWER AND TORQUE

The 1998 Trooper features a significantly improved and refined engine. The engine is tuned specifically to take full advantage of the new Torque on Demand (TOD),™ drive system.

Engine size, horsepower and torque have all been increased. The new engine displaces 213 cubic inches (3.50 liters) versus the 193 cubic inches (3.165 liters) of the previous version. Horsepower is up 13 percent, from 190 @ 5600 rpm, to 215 @ 5400 rpm. At the same time, torque output has been increased from 188 lb. ft. @ 4000 rpm to 230 lb. ft.@ 3000 rpm, an improvement of 22 percent. The engine has been made lighter and simpler.

Breathing is made easier through the application of a four-valve, dual-overhead cam design, with direct actuation of the valves. By eliminating the rocker arms, rocker- ann shafts and hydraulic valve lifters, reliability has been improved, noise, vibration and harshness diminished, the system simplified and costs reduced. Improved responsiveness and output have been achieved through a combination of newly developed cross-flow straight configuration intake ports, and variable length intake ports, providing power increases throughout the entire rev range.

The variable air-intake system employs a butterfly valve that effectively lengthens or shortens the length of the intake track depending on the operating speed of the engine. Below 3600 rpm the valve closes, effectively lengthening the intake track. The longer track increases the volume of air, providing high torque at low and intermediate speeds.

As engine speed increases, over 3600 rpm, the solenoid switch turns off, shortening the port and providing high torque at high speeds. Cylinder heads are of die-cast aluminum alloy with pent-roof type combustion chambers. The included valve angle is 19, making the combustion chambers very compact. Squish areas are provided to allow reliable combustion at low rpm.

Major effort has been put into reducing friction as a means to increase output. As an example, camshafts have been micro-polished to reduce frictional resistance. Low-tension valve springs are employed along with short skirt pistons and groove bearings for connecting rods and main bearing surfaces. Direct valve actuation further contributes to the reduction of power-sapping friction as well as contributing to overall weight reduction. Attention has also been focused on mainta&127ining low intake air temperatures. The air intake duct has been moved from under the hood, to a position inside the left front wheel well outside the engine compartment. Pheonolic plastic gaskets further isolate the intake chamber from the cylinder head, reducing intake air temperatures and contributing to the overall power increase. Noise, vibration and harshness have also been improved. The engine features a two-stage aluminum crankcase and steel oil pan combination that produces greater power plant rigidity and a reduction in noise and vibration. Rubber is used in isolating the cylinder head and timing belt covers, to further reduce noise and vibration. Additionally, a combination of two-stage reduction gear drive and a backlash-free configuration for the camshaft drive gears reduce noise while giving precise valve timing.

The need for maintenance is reduced with the application of platinum tipped spark-plugs and a six-tooth, polyester serpentine auxiliary belt drive. The platinum plugs are good for 100,000 miles and the belt is equipped urith an auto-tensioner that requires no manual adjustment, extending the service life of the engine.

For 1998, all Troopers feature improved fuel consumption, and a high degree of quietness. At the same time, by simplifying various systems and structures, the vehicle's cost competitiveness has been enhanced. The Trooper is covered by one of the best, most comprehensive warranties and roadside assistance programs in the industry, including: 36-month/50,000-mile bumper-to-bumper warranty, a 60-month/60,000-mile powertrain limited warranty and a 72-month/100,000-mile rust perforation limited warranty and free 24-hour, 365-day roadside assistance.
